LocalPetShops.net
Home
/
Indiana
/
Wabash
Pet Shops in Wabash, Indiana
Showing 1 Pet Shops
Expand
Collapse
J & K's Mega Pet!
(260) 563-0352
1425 N Cass St
Wabash, Indiana
View Listing